Work Sample Guidelines

Applicants must provide high-quality, digital work samples (links or attachments –jpg, mp3, pdf,etc.). Samples must be of artist’s work only. Hard copies will not be accepted. Work must be completed within the past three years. Applicants must attach an inventory list with the
following descriptions for the applicable discipline:
​
*For video and audio work samples: please note that due to file sizes, YouTube and Vimeo links are preferred for video. Do not upload MP4s directly to the application. Please indicate if the work sample is professionally mastered on your Inventory List.
Writing: Fiction, creative nonfiction, and playwrights may submit no more than 12 pages each of one to two manuscripts. Poets may submit five to seven poems. Playwrights may also submit documentation of a recorded performance or staged reading of their plays (videos, clip not to exceed five minutes.)

Visual Art and Craft: Up to 15 images of your work.
o Description: date of completion, medium, and dimensions.
o Time-based work can be documented with video, up to five minutes.

Film: Documentation of one or more completed films. (Video clips not to exceed five minutes.)
o Description: include date and location of performance, title of piece, names and roles of key people, including directors, choreographers, lead
performers/actors, etc. A short summary may also be included.
 Dance and Performing Arts: Documentation of up to three recorded performances. Videos uploaded may not exceed a total time of ten minutes.
o Description: include date and location of performance, title of piece, names and roles of key people, including directors, choreographers, lead
performers/actors, etc. A short summary may also be included.

Music: Documentation of up to three recorded performances, live or studio. Audio or video uploaded may not exceed a total time of ten minutes.
o Description: include date and location of performance, title of piece, names and roles of key people, including directors, choreographers, lead
performers/actors, etc. A short summary may also be included.
o Composers and songwriters should also submit scores, lyrics, and/or lead
sheets, as appropriate.
